这款Moto智能手机相对较轻,也比同级别的其他智能手机更紧凑,但对小手来说可能还是太大了。外壳是由PMMA制成的,一种也被称为有机玻璃的塑料。它看起来非常结实,几乎不可能被扭曲,但在强大的压力下会出现裂缝。

由于背面有圆形的玻璃边缘,这款智能手机使用起来感觉很好,而且其相对平直的侧面看起来相当现代。但在操作该设备时,各种表面材料之间的过渡是很明显的。颜色有深灰色和乳白色,这两种颜色的背面都有精致的圆点图案装饰。不幸的是,我们的灰色测试设备被证明相当容易受到指纹的影响。

Moto G82 5G具有IP52等级,这意味着可以防止灰尘。然而,在对液体的保护方面,这款智能手机只被认证为防水(而不是防水),所以它不应该被浸泡在水中。

软件。只有偶尔的更新

Android 12作为摩托罗拉MyUX的基础,与股票 ,几乎没有区别。所有的扩展,如手势控制或设计设置,都集中在Moto应用程序中。Android

在我们审查过程开始时,安全补丁是2022年3月的,因此急需更新。在审查接近尾声时,我们收到了一个更新(2022年6月),这表明你应该只期待每3个月的更新。总的来说,摩托罗拉只为其智能手机提供3年的安全更新。在系统更新方面,承诺提供两个主要的Android ,但其他供应商,如诺基亚或三星,现在提供的要多得多。

提供DRM-L1认证,因此在Netflix等应用中可以实现高清流媒体。

通信和全球导航卫星系统:可在许多国家使用

Moto G82提供Wi-Fi 5作为最快的Wi-Fi标准。在与我们的华硕ROG AXE11000参考路由器的测试中,该智能手机实现了体面的传输速率,但 一加Nord CE 2总体上要快得多。在发送和接收时,传输率都非常稳定。

当然,安装了5G(最新的移动标准),也可以使用5G单机。许多4G频率是可用的,所以该手机可以在大量国家用于移动互联网接入。

在审查期间,我们还随机测试了该智能手机的接收质量,并与我们数据库中的各种高端手机进行了比较。的确,Moto G82有很强的接收能力,即使是在室内。

在户外,需要一段时间才能准确定位,精确度为4米。可用的卫星种类足够多,但也有其他智能手机有更多的连接。

为了进行实际测试,我们去骑自行车,并拿Garmin Venu 2智能手表作比较。

Moto G82的跟踪并不那么精确:即使在问题较少、有很多空地的地区,也不能准确地跟踪路线,当我们过桥时,智能手机部分地将我们置于水中。因此,重视准确定位的用户应该到其他地方去看看。

电话和语音质量。只有中等程度的清晰对话

这里使用的是谷歌的电话应用,设计整齐,也被许多其他厂商使用,所以适应Moto G82的使用应该是没有问题的。

在打电话时,建议使用听筒而不是内置的扬声器。听筒的声音相当清晰,麦克风也能很清楚地捕捉到我们的声音,但前提是你必须相当大声地说话。在通过免提模块和扬声器进行通话时,你也不应该说得太小声,否则接收器将听不到任何声音。不过,扬声器听起来也很闷,在最大音量时再现的是可闻的噪音。

照相机。摩托G82的主摄像头为OIS

用主摄像头拍照
用主摄像头拍照

在Moto G82的价格范围内,典型的功能是一个5000万像素的主摄像头,全高清视频录制,以及一个广角和一个微距镜头。我们的评测样本拥有所有这些和更多。主摄像头通过光学图像稳定技术提供额外的防抖保护--这是一个不错的功能,否则很难用这么少的钱买到。

Moto G82的主摄像头通常不以全分辨率拍照,而只使用四分之一,使像素更大,更感光。图像清晰度处于中等水平,在非常明亮的地方可以看到轻微的发花。不幸的是,该相机系统只能在非常低的光线和高对比度的环境中提供基本的照明。这款手机 realme 9 Pro例如,在这方面做得更好。

广角摄像头缺乏细节,在边缘处明显失去了锐度,但仍适用于快照。前面的自拍相机的分辨率为1600万像素,为放大图像提供了足够的细节。

视频可以用全高清录制,最多60帧。这款手机 OnePlus Nord CE 2相比之下,提供4K录制。自动对焦和亮度调节的反应不时有点迟钝,图像在黑暗区域会变得有颗粒感。视频功能可用于简短的记录,但在这个价格范围内有质量更好的相机。

显示屏。摩托罗拉用很少的钱提供了一个OLED

子像素网格
子像素网格
直流调光
直流调光

摩托G82 5G的OLED屏幕可以变得相当明亮。它在亮度方面并不接近高端智能手机,但在其价格范围内是最好的,平均亮度为640尼特。稍微扩大的全高清分辨率也是级别标准。

我们观察到典型的PWM闪烁,但摩托罗拉在其软件中(即在显示器设置中)集成了一个直流调光模式,作为一个名为 "防止闪烁 "的选项。这将闪烁统一调整为刷新率,从而补救了这一问题,并防止对许多用户造成困扰。然而,在低亮度时,颜色也会变得失真。

Screen Flickering / PWM (Pulse-Width Modulation)

To dim the screen, some notebooks will simply cycle the backlight on and off in rapid succession - a method called Pulse Width Modulation (PWM) . This cycling frequency should ideally be undetectable to the human eye. If said frequency is too low, users with sensitive eyes may experience strain or headaches or even notice the flickering altogether.
Screen flickering / PWM detected 119.4 Hz

The display backlight flickers at 119.4 Hz (worst case, e.g., utilizing PWM) .

The frequency of 119.4 Hz is very low, so the flickering may cause eyestrain and headaches after extended use.

In comparison: 53 % of all tested devices do not use PWM to dim the display. If PWM was detected, an average of 17900 (minimum: 5 - maximum: 3846000) Hz was measured.

镜头下的画面是固定的放大镜和不一样的智能显示

在我们用分光光度计和CalMAN软件进行的测量中,红色在 "自然 "色彩曲线中的代表性明显不足。因此,画面显得很冷,一些颜色值与最佳值有很大的偏差。那些想获得最准确的色彩再现的人最好到其他地方去看看。

另一方面,OLED屏幕确保了(理论上)黑色的完整呈现,因为个别像素可以简单地关闭,所以对比度看起来相当好,颜色也很明亮。

表现。典型的中产阶级力量

使用 高通Snapdragon 695作为SoC,Moto G82 5G在性能方面在同等价位的中端手机中表现不俗。同样, 一加Nord CE 2采用了 联发科Dimensity 900稍微快一点,但在日常使用中不太可能注意到这些差异。

总的来说,Moto智能手机的性能对于目前绝大部分的应用程序来说应该是足够的。然而,性能储备是有限的,例如在多任务处理时,你会很快注意到。

游戏:不应期待120帧

在我们的游戏测试中,我们的评测样本无法利用其屏幕的全部120赫兹,但我们在快速的2D游戏(如Armajet)中注册了一个稳定的60帧。如果你喜欢玩像《PUBG移动版》这样的射击游戏,并希望获得高帧率,那么低设置下的最高40帧是不可能满足的。我们使用GameBench的工具确定帧率。工具来确定帧率。

摩托罗拉提供了自己的游戏覆盖,称为GameTime,它允许你在游戏时关闭恼人的通知,禁用自动亮度调节,并使用许多其他有用的工具。

排放。负载下无节流现象

温度

高负荷时的最高温度处于通常水平。因此,Moto G82在高环境温度下可能会变得不舒服。

在日常使用中,该智能手机运行稳定,即使在长时间的负载下也没有性能损失,3DMark压力测试证明了这一点。

发言人

尽管摩托罗拉指定在Moto G82 5G中安装了立体声扬声器,但上部的扬声器实际上是听筒。这几乎没有实际的扬声器那么响亮,所以立体声效果并不明显。总的来说,音质相当好,即使在最大音量下,扬声器也不会听起来失真。最后,扬声器在听音乐时听起来不像在打电话时那么闷。

一个好的方面是3.5毫米插孔。那些已经拥有无线耳机的人可以通过蓝牙使用目前的各种编解码器,包括aptX TWS+和LHDC v3。

电池寿命。大电池,有良好的持久力

消耗功率

对于同价位的智能手机来说,Moto G82的耗电行为相当正常,稍大的屏幕似乎也没有造成耗电的增加。

这款智能手机的最大充电功率为30瓦,由附带的电源适配器提供。总的充电时间约为1小时。如果你的时间较少,10分钟的充电将给你带来几个小时的使用。

电池寿命

与这个价格区间的其他智能手机相比,摩托罗拉Moto G82的5000毫安时电池很有冲击力。有趣的是,尽管电池很大,Moto G82仍然是一部相当轻的智能手机。

我们在Wi-Fi测试中记录了17小时的超长电池运行时间。因此,用户可以合理地期待两个工作日的正常使用。总的来说,这款Moto智能手机提供了非常好的,但不是破纪录的耐力。

结论:魔鬼在细节中

通过Moto G82 5G,摩托罗拉在市场上带来了一款坚实的中档手机,乍一看很普通。但它确实在几个细节上从竞争中脱颖而出。在这个价格范围内,几乎没有任何其他智能手机为主摄像头提供光学图像稳定功能。此外,许多蓝牙编解码器可用于无线耳机或扬声器的高质量声音。

外壳看起来很光滑,甚至可以防止灰尘和水的飞溅。许多4G频率使全球使用成为可能,移动网络的信号质量很好。显示屏很亮,配备了直流调光功能,触摸屏在使用中很可靠。

然而,摩托罗拉的Moto G82 5G并非完全没有批评之处。例如,它在软件更新的频率和持续时间方面都有不足;在过去的一年里,竞争对手在这方面已经取得了很大的优势。此外,通话质量相当差,由于缺乏大猩猩玻璃,很难确定显示屏的保护程度。

总的来说,Moto G82是一款可靠的中端手机,电池寿命长,OLED屏幕,价格低廉。

那些希望获得更多性能和具有4K视频录制功能的智能手机最好选择 OnePlus Nord CE 2。更长的软件更新和寿命可以在下列手机中找到 诺基亚X10.
